Welcome to Gael Mackie's official website! Gael, an 18-year-old gymnast from Vancouver, British Columbia, is one of the leading ladies in Canadian gymnastics. Following success at the junior level, Gael burst onto the senior scene in 2003. After winning the national championships at age 14, she was immediately considered to be one of the major contenders for a spot on the Olympic team that would travel to Athens a year later. In the summer of 2004, all of Gael's hard work paid off. After a long and tedious selection process, the Canadian Olympic team was announced, and Gael's biggest dream had become a reality. She made the team and will forever be known as an Olympian.

Since Athens, Gael has assumed the position of a veteran and looks to lead the new generation of up-and-coming gymnasts. She has countless national and international competitions on her resume and is well-known for her beautiful lines, dance, and personality. Gael has already been offered and accepted a full scholarship to the University of Utah and she will begin her education and collegiate gymnastics career in the fall of 2008. With the Olympics next summer still a possibility, Gael's experience and determination will guide her towards accomplishing any goal she dreams possible.
